mysql vs mysqlMax

b b

Hi,
When installing the mysql4 binary it works fine. When
installing the mysql max4 binary I get the following
message when I try to run mysqld_safe. I am running
linux redhat 9.1. Would anyone know why this is
happening?

030728 23:54:57 mysqld started
030728 23:54:58 bdb:
/usr/local/mysql/data/log.0000000001: Permission
denied
030728 23:54:58 bdb: PANIC: Permission denied
030728 23:54:58 Can't init databases
030728 23:54:58 Aborting

030728 23:54:58 /usr/local/mysql/bin/mysqld: Shutdown
Complete

030728 23:54:58 mysqld ended
If mysql max is hopeless, how would you propose one
could get around to using transactions and stored
procedures since mysql alone doesn't do it.

Looks like it is trying to initialise the Berkley DB.

I thought InnoDB (which is transactional) was included by default in the
MySQL4 Binary, you may just need to set your my.ini file to use it.
